Who owns Alaska USA bank?

Alaska USA Federal Credit Union is a not-for-profit financial services cooperative, owned by more than 705,000 members throughout the United States and around the world. Alaska USA is a leading credit union in the U.S. and one of the largest financial institutions in the state of Alaska.

When did Alaska join USA?

The Senate approved the treaty of purchase on April 9; President Andrew Johnson signed the treaty on May 28, and Alaska was formally transferred to the United States on October 18, 1867. This purchase ended Russia’s presence in North America and ensured U.S. access to the Pacific northern rim.

Can you drive to Alaska from America?

You can drive to Alaska from anywhere in the United States except Hawaii. From the majority of USA, you need to take the Alaska Highway from Dawson Creek in British Columbia except California, Oregon and Washington State where the Dease Lake Highway is a better route to Yukon. Jan 23, 2020

Is Alaska attached to the US?

Alaska is separated from the 48 contiguous U.S. states by Canada. The Bering Strait, a strait between the Pacific and Arctic Oceans, separates Asia (the Chukchi Peninsula of Russia) from North America (the Seward Peninsula of Alaska). Alaska is one of two US states not bordered by another state; Hawaii is the other. 5 days ago

How much can I withdraw Alaska USA?

What is the maximum amount I can withdraw from an ATM? All Alaska USA debit cards have a daily withdrawal limit of $1019 per card, with $1000 accessible to members, and the extra $19 to cover any non-Alaska USA ATM fees.
